Mirdir can backup directories

Posted on November 27, 2005

Linux and Open Source Blog:”Mirdir provides a quick and easy way to make an ad hoc backup of important data. With it you can copy a file or directories to your keydisk, or save redundant copies of data you can’t afford to lose. It tries to do only one thing, and do it well: mirror a directory.”
